Also known as Bukit Lalang- named after the species of grass that grows abundantly all over the area-, Broga Hill is said to be a place where British-sided rebels fought against the Japanese during World War II.  Because of that, some believe that the town is haunted by those who were massacred during the time of the Imperial Japanese.
